php查询数据库的问题

用php在一个数据库里选择一个表中的所有元组:mysql_query("select*fromadmin")能够正确输出结果但是加上where以后:mysql_query... 用php在一个数据库里选择一个表中的所有元组:
mysql_query("select * from admin")
能够正确输出结果
但是加上where以后:
mysql_query("select * from admin where A#='$id'")
就不选择任何结果(实际应该有结果的),为什么啊?
已经说过了,理应输出结果的,但是没有,所以不要回答“条件不符合”之类的
展开
 我来答
wscsq789
2013-05-12 · 超过13用户采纳过TA的回答
知道答主
回答量:47
采纳率:0%
帮助的人:38.7万
展开全部
mysql_query("select * from admin where 'A#'='".$id."'")
试试这个
jiangxibaiyi
2013-05-12 · 跟随风去旅行-伤心的歌
jiangxibaiyi
采纳数:3973 获赞数:14412

向TA提问 私信TA
展开全部
mysql数据库中的sql语句,似乎没有 #=的语法哦
你是想返回什么样条件的数据嘛?
追问
那个元组的属性叫A#
追答
where 子语句似乎只能比较字段哦
当然,个人看法
你输出一下上一次mysql数据库操作错误提示,看看他给你什么样才错误提示嘛
这样很直观的能知道错在哪里啊
mysql_query("select * from admin where A#='$id'");
echo mysql_error();
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
sf...e@126.com
2013-05-12
知道答主
回答量:1
采纳率:0%
帮助的人:1503
展开全部
添加了条件啦 ,,条件不符合,肯定没有结果咯.
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
啊欢哥
2013-05-12 · TA获得超过158个赞
知道答主
回答量:329
采纳率:0%
帮助的人:138万
展开全部
A#有这个字段吗?
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式